In the art world, various roles contribute to the industry's growth and development. Our Certificate in Fauvism Art History: A Concise Guide provides a solid foundation for several positions. Here's a 3D pie chart visualizing the job market trends for these roles in the United Kingdom. Art Curator: With a 40% share in the market, art curators are in high demand. They're responsible for managing collections, conducting public service activities, and organizing art exhibitions. Art Gallery Manager: Art gallery managers have a 25% share in the market. They ensure the smooth operation of galleries, coordinate events, and collaborate with artists and curators. Museum Education Specialist: With a 20% share, museum education specialists design and implement educational programs for museums and galleries, blending art history and pedagogical strategies. Art Consultant: Art consultants possess a 10% share in the market. They advise clients on art acquisition, collection management, and art-related investments. Art Authenticator: Finally, art authenticators have a 5% share in the market. They verify the authenticity of art pieces, often working with auction houses, galleries, and private collectors. These roles demonstrate the diverse and exciting career paths available in the art industry, with our Certificate in Fauvism Art History: A Concise Guide providing a solid starting point.
